Heady TopperHeady Topper
Notes: Heady Topper is an American double IPA. This beer is not intended to be the biggest or most bitter. It is meant to give you wave after wave of hoppy goodness on your palate. Tremendous amounts of American hops will creep up on you, and leave you with a dense hoppy finish in you mouth. So drinkable, it's scary. Sometimes I wish I could crawl right into the can.

Freshness and control have always been my main concern when it comes to our beer. We are committed to providing you with an unfiltered and unpasteurized hop experience. Why do I recommend that you drink it from the can? Quite simply, to ensure a delightful hop experience. The act of pouring it in a glass smells nice, but it releases the essential hop aromas that we have work so hard to retain.

If you MUST pour it into a glass, you may find that some of the hop resins have settled to the bottom -- leave them in the can while pouring. This beer is perishable, and at its best when it is young, fresh and hazy. Keep it cold, but not ice cold. Drink this beer immediately, we are always making more. -- John Kimmich


75 IBU

Fresh (canned November 25/22) - found unexpectedly at Chip's Liquor in San Diego.
Pours a bright but hazy golden orange with a finger plus of foamy bubbly white head.
The aroma is a burst of hops on opening the can (yeah I had to pour it out) - citrus, piney, pine resin, and tropical fruit. The grainy malt takes a back seat, but adds to the amazing nose.
Tastes delightfully sweet - orange, citrus hops explode on the palate - pine resin, tropical fruit - there is a touch of pithiness but subtle and adds rather than detracts; pale grainy malt underpins balancing a moderate delicious bitterness.
Smooth with moderate carbonation - medium full mouthfeel with no sense of the 8% ABV and a lingering citrus bittersweetness.

16oz can. Can bottom is stamped 'Canned On 09-29-22'.
For reference, a couple of ounces have been poured into a glass. The body is partly cloudy, and is straw colored. Looks to be a strong one finger white head. The couple of ounces in the glass left behind a generous ring and other spots of lacing.
Aroma is hop driven - citrus dank and pine resin. Solid toasted malt base.
Taste is grapefruit and orange pith, which melds into the pleasant bitterness. Pine resin is there and expresses more at the end and in the aftertaste. Solid malt base. There is also a resin sweetness that exists more in the front part of the profile.
Mouth feel is more than medium, and has a softer quality. Excellent carbonation in the mouth.
This beer is world class, and will be especially attractive to those IPA drinkers who like some pine resin and bitterness. The beer is truly expressive in the mouth, and is a big reason why it is so well regarded. Really a great tasting IPA.
